some of the renderers use

atom.getScreenX()

and some use

atom.screenX

They are the same; Atom.getScreenX() simply returns screenX

Q: would it be reasonable to just get rid of "getScreenX()"? I 
understand that generally one wants to expose methods like this, not the 
variable itself, but in this case, it isn't a public method, and it is 
used SO much, wouldn't it be marginally faster and programmatically "OK" 
to just reference the variable itself?
